<p>A thin blanket of snow fell in Santiago and the surrounding metropolitan area over the weekend of July 15 due to a rare winter cold snap. The city has now seen snow since 2011, Accuweather</a> reported.</p><p>This footage shows the snowfall in Maipu, a commune located in Santiago Province, about 11 miles from the city center.</p><p>Temperatures were expected to remain frigid through the weekend, with a minimum temperature of 3 degrees Celsius (37 Fahrenheit) and a maximum of 8 Celsius (46 Fahrenheit) expected for Saturday, according to Latercera</a>.
